Management Meeting Minutes — Large-Deal Discounts

Attendees: regional sales leads; chaired by Petra Vallin. Agreed: discounts above 18% on Corvane platform deals now require pricing-desk approval. Deals under the Ashgrove threshold keep current delegation. Rolling 90-day margin report to be circulated monthly. Two exceptions granted last quarter were reviewed; both deemed justified. Next review set for the Harlowe offsite. The confidential note on forward plans follows below.

management briefing: Project Ulavan slips by two quarters because of the staffing delay.

While auditing the Lanternjet deploy pipeline, I found that the canary gating rules in the Westmere cluster no longer match the committed baseline. Someone raised the error-rate threshold and shortened the bake window manually, likely during the Quillhaven incident, and never backported the change. Future maintainers: always edit the baseline repo first, then sync clusters, never the reverse. For the record, the intended canonical gating configuration is reproduced in full below.

settings of taguf-fajef:
[eliath]
team = julir
access_code = ac_78465c
host = eliath.lumicgrid.local
port = 8443
owner = feniel.wenir
peer = quenmir.tolvaqsys.local

**14:22 UTC** — Migration wave 3 on Quillbase began. Dual-write enabled for the ledger tables; reads still on old schema. 14:31 — lag alarm fired, false positive from the shadow replica. 14:40 — cutover completed, zero dropped requests confirmed by Marisol's canary probes. Backfill finished 14:58. No rollback needed. The migration artifact that shipped is identified by the token below.

pipeline stamp: htk6_35e0c9

## Ownership

The cron drift investigation for the Pellwick scheduler lives here. If jobs fire more than 90 seconds late, check the drift dashboard first, then the NTP sync logs on the runner pool. Do not restart the scheduler without capturing a timing snapshot — we lose the evidence. Escalations go through the Pellwick channel. The person responsible for this investigation is named below.

account owner for fajep-yagef: Kasix Eliiel